Chapter 658

"Do you think I'll ever see him again?" the child asked, his big eyes brimming with panic and worry.

Eliza's heart ached at the sight. She reached out and gently patted his head. "Not right now, sweetie."

"And later on?"

"Later... I'm not sure," Eliza admitted, feeling the weight of uncertainty.

The little guy seemed to grasp her hesitation, his fluffy head drooping slowly. "Thanks, ma'am. I'll head back now."

He turned and started walking away, his small figure moving in the opposite direction.

Watching him take those few steps, Eliza called out, "Where are you going? There's no one at home to look after you."

"I can take care of myself, ma'am," he replied, his head hanging low as he trudged along the wall, like he'd done something wrong.

The sun cast a long shadow behind his small frame, making the scene feel even more desolate and lonely.

Eliza's heart softened; she felt a pang of discomfort watching him leave. But what could she do? If she brought Dylan back, Fiona would probably accuse her of kidnapping.

Just as Eliza left the police station, a dark car pulled up at the entrance.

The back door opened, and a tall man stepped out, removing his sunglasses to glance at the station's entrance. He paused briefly before heading inside.
